To get the most out of your printable bill budget organizer, there are a few tips to keep in mind. First, be sure to update your organizer regularly. This will help you stay on top of your finances and ensure that you're always aware of your financial situation. Second, be honest with yourself about your spending habits. If you're not tracking your expenses accurately, you won't get an accurate picture of your finances. Finally, don't be afraid to make adjustments as needed. Your budget should be a flexible document that changes as your financial situation changes.
